              II.  CHANGE IN NAME OF ISSUER

     1.  Name prior to change: First Alabama Bancshares, Inc.

     2.  Name after change: Regions Financial Corporation

     3.  Effective date of charter amendment changing name: May 2, 1994.

     4.  Date of shareholder approval of change, if required: April 27, 1994.
